## Releases

Stagecraft is the seat-map renderer for the Orpheline Theatre booking site. We cut a release whenever the venue changes its seating layout, which is more often than you'd think. Tag the build, run `make bundle`, and hand it to the Fennick deploy script — it does the rest, including cache busting on the CDN. One thing you can't skip: every bundle has to be signed. The release signing key is:

rollout seal: bky9_aBG1gvAyU

Subject: Visitor handling overnight

Dear night-shift colleagues,

A reminder on visitor procedure at Marrowgate Tower. Between 20:00 and 07:00, all visitors must be pre-registered by their host; walk-ins are not admitted. Check photo identification, record the arrival time in the overnight log, and issue a dated visitor sticker. Escort guests to the lift lobby and confirm the host collects them in person — never send visitors up alone. If the visitor badge printer is offline, admit registered guests through the side gate using the code below.

badge for tawip-hagug: bdg-JAZUYR-57471969

Welcome to the TideGlance widget team! Since you're reviewing us for security sign-off, here's the quick tour: the widget pulls tide predictions from our Harborline service, caches them locally for 12 hours, and renders entirely client-side. No user data leaves the device. Builds are reproducible and signed before every release. For verification, the deploy key we sign with is as follows.

signing key of bagap-yawep = bky13_TbfT6ZMUoGJo2